Transaction 1733196e39a42d18a1948743de53aa5f736998564616a21ef74174eec8c70610
1 Input
1 Output
-
1733196e39a42d18a1948743de53aa5f736998564616a21ef74174eec8c70610:0
- value
- 519593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e28d57195e8f85ef9b8d961d98de7562edee12ff OP_EQUAL
- address
- 3NLuxPWHhaNDV7nEXqeFd3X8khxNix2Leq